Yahaya Idris, Adavi.

Adavi communities of Kogi State has commended their Chief Security officer of the council and Executive Chairman, Hon Joseph Omuya Salami for his various impacts since the assumption of office a year ago.

The communities comprising 159 on Tuesday, January 25, 2022, met through their various representatives to appreciate the council boss for his immense contribution to the development of the area.

Speaking through the community leader and Chairman of the forum Alhaji Husein Aduvusu in his welcome address says since the creation of Adavi LG the area had never had it good as in the case of Joseph Omuya Salami led council administration, notes that the Executive Chairman has brought sanity, provides maximum, empowerment of women, youths, health and education support among others.

Aduvusu also noted that the Executive Chairman’s pragmatic leadership styles have endeared him to his people and especially the 159 communities in Adavi LG who were overwhelmed with his people’s oriented policies and programs designed to provide succour to the citizens.

Alhaji Husein Aduvusu maintained that given the inclusive leadership prowess of the Executive Chairman, 159 communities in them during their special collective sitting decided to passed a vote of confidence on their leader as part of efforts to encourage him to do more.

“We are gathered here to honour our Executive Chairman, Hon. Joseph Omuya Salami who has distinguished himself among his peers, is a true son of the soil and we are proud of him” the community said.

Speaking further, the community representative Mr Maman, who equally congratulated the Chairman for winning the trust of vast electorates in Adavi LG, said such can only come when a leader has performed beyond a reasonable doubt. He describes Mr Salami administration as athe s best in the history of the council while urging him not to relent in pursuing some critical agenda and programs that will have to bear the populace of the area.

He assured him of the community robust cordial relations as he made some compassionate appeals for completion of the town hall projects and to assist towards facilitating well-designed bye-laws for the interest of peaceful coexistence of all the communities in the area.

A press statement issued on 24 January 2022, by Oseni S O. Bukky, Senior Special Assistant, SSA, Media & Publicity to Adavi LG Chairman, quoted Hon. Joseph Omuya Salami appreciated them for the support, prayers and solidarity he enjoyed from the undersigned noble communities when he said assisted his administration right from the time served as an Administrator of the council.

The chairman pledged to look into their demands and subsequently move into action. He also said the projects if completed will go a long way in serving the people of the area.

” I will look into the two issues led before me and I will give it an urgent intervention, most importantly the issue of bye-laws,” he said.

He thanked Governor Yahaya Bello for providing him with the platform and opportunity to explore and pledged to sustain the tempo.
